Who We Are

Imprint is reimagining co-branded credit cards & financial products to be smarter, more rewarding, and truly brand-first. We partner with companies like Rakuten, , H-E-B, Fetch, and Brooks Brothers to launch modern credit programs that deepen loyalty, unlock savings, and drive growth. Our platform combines advanced payments infrastructure, intelligent underwriting, and seamless UX to help brands offer powerful financial products—without becoming a bank.

Co-branded cards account for over $300 billion in U.S. annual spend—but most are still powered by legacy banks. Imprint is the modern alternative: flexible, tech-forward, and built for today’s consumer. Backed by Kleiner Perkins, Thrive Capital, and Khosla Ventures, we’re building a world-class team to redefine how people pay—and how brands grow.
